mirror of
https://github.com/MarginaliaSearch/MarginaliaSearch.git
synced 2025-02-23 13:09:00 +00:00
(search, experimental) Add a few debugging tracks to the search UI
This commit is contained in:
parent
20b24133fb
commit
c67a635103
@ -320,6 +320,8 @@ public class SearchOperator {
|
|||||||
// Return the results to the user
|
// Return the results to the user
|
||||||
return DecoratedSearchResults.builder()
|
return DecoratedSearchResults.builder()
|
||||||
.params(userParams)
|
.params(userParams)
|
||||||
|
.problems(List.of())
|
||||||
|
.evalResult("")
|
||||||
.results(clusteredResults)
|
.results(clusteredResults)
|
||||||
.filters(new SearchFilters(userParams))
|
.filters(new SearchFilters(userParams))
|
||||||
.focusDomain(focusDomain)
|
.focusDomain(focusDomain)
|
||||||
@ -353,6 +355,8 @@ public class SearchOperator {
|
|||||||
// Return the results to the user
|
// Return the results to the user
|
||||||
return DecoratedSearchResults.builder()
|
return DecoratedSearchResults.builder()
|
||||||
.params(userParams)
|
.params(userParams)
|
||||||
|
.problems(List.of())
|
||||||
|
.evalResult("")
|
||||||
.results(clusteredResults)
|
.results(clusteredResults)
|
||||||
.filters(new SearchFilters(userParams))
|
.filters(new SearchFilters(userParams))
|
||||||
.focusDomain(focusDomain)
|
.focusDomain(focusDomain)
|
||||||
@ -382,6 +386,8 @@ public class SearchOperator {
|
|||||||
// Return the results to the user
|
// Return the results to the user
|
||||||
return DecoratedSearchResults.builder()
|
return DecoratedSearchResults.builder()
|
||||||
.params(userParams)
|
.params(userParams)
|
||||||
|
.problems(List.of())
|
||||||
|
.evalResult("")
|
||||||
.results(clusteredResults)
|
.results(clusteredResults)
|
||||||
.filters(new SearchFilters(userParams))
|
.filters(new SearchFilters(userParams))
|
||||||
.focusDomain(null)
|
.focusDomain(null)
|
||||||
|
@ -32,19 +32,19 @@ public class SearchCommand implements SearchCommandInterface {
|
|||||||
else if (parameters.debug() == 1) {
|
else if (parameters.debug() == 1) {
|
||||||
DecoratedSearchResults results = searchOperator.doSearchFastTrack1(parameters);
|
DecoratedSearchResults results = searchOperator.doSearchFastTrack1(parameters);
|
||||||
return Optional.of(new MapModelAndView("serp/main.jte",
|
return Optional.of(new MapModelAndView("serp/main.jte",
|
||||||
Map.of("parameters", results, "navbar", NavbarModel.SEARCH)
|
Map.of("results", results, "navbar", NavbarModel.SEARCH)
|
||||||
));
|
));
|
||||||
}
|
}
|
||||||
else if (parameters.debug() == 2) {
|
else if (parameters.debug() == 2) {
|
||||||
DecoratedSearchResults results = searchOperator.doSearchFastTrack2(parameters);
|
DecoratedSearchResults results = searchOperator.doSearchFastTrack2(parameters);
|
||||||
return Optional.of(new MapModelAndView("serp/main.jte",
|
return Optional.of(new MapModelAndView("serp/main.jte",
|
||||||
Map.of("parameters", results, "navbar", NavbarModel.SEARCH)
|
Map.of("results", results, "navbar", NavbarModel.SEARCH)
|
||||||
));
|
));
|
||||||
}
|
}
|
||||||
else if (parameters.debug() == 3) {
|
else if (parameters.debug() == 3) {
|
||||||
DecoratedSearchResults results = searchOperator.doSearchFastTrack3(parameters);
|
DecoratedSearchResults results = searchOperator.doSearchFastTrack3(parameters);
|
||||||
return Optional.of(new MapModelAndView("serp/main.jte",
|
return Optional.of(new MapModelAndView("serp/main.jte",
|
||||||
Map.of("parameters", results, "navbar", NavbarModel.SEARCH)
|
Map.of("results", results, "navbar", NavbarModel.SEARCH)
|
||||||
));
|
));
|
||||||
}
|
}
|
||||||
else {
|
else {
|
||||||
|
Loading…
Reference in New Issue
Block a user